From 76b47e528e3a27a3bf3b3f9153aad9435e03be8c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dave Chinner Date: Thu, 7 Jul 2022 19:07:32 +1000 Subject: xfs: kill xfs_alloc_pagf_init() Trivial wrapper around xfs_alloc_read_agf(), can be easily replaced by passing a NULL agfbp to xfs_alloc_read_agf().
